Understanding Your Needs and Goals

Before you even begin researching potential agencies, it’s crucial to clearly define your website’s objectives and target audience. What do you want your website to achieve? Are you aiming to generate leads, drive sales, or simply provide information? Understanding these aspects will allow you to better communicate your requirements to prospective agencies and assess their suitability for your project.

  • Define Your Objectives: Clearly outline what you want to achieve with your website (e.g., lead generation, e-commerce, brand awareness).
  • Identify Your Target Audience: Understand their demographics, needs, and online behavior.
  • Determine Your Budget: Establish a realistic budget for the web design project.

Researching and Evaluating Potential Agencies

Once you have a clear understanding of your needs, you can begin researching web design agencies. Look for agencies with a strong portfolio, relevant experience, and positive client testimonials. Don’t hesitate to ask for references and speak to previous clients to get a firsthand account of their experience.

Key Factors to Consider:

  1. Portfolio: Review the agency’s portfolio to assess the quality and style of their work.
  2. Experience: Look for agencies with experience in your industry or with similar types of projects.
  3. Client Testimonials: Read testimonials and reviews to gauge client satisfaction.
  4. Communication: Evaluate the agency’s communication style and responsiveness.
  5. Pricing: Compare pricing models and ensure transparency in cost estimates.

The Importance of Communication and Collaboration

Effective communication is essential for a successful web design project. Choose an agency that is responsive, transparent, and willing to collaborate closely with you throughout the process. Regular communication and feedback sessions will ensure that the final product aligns with your vision and meets your expectations.
